Anyone know what brand(JR, Airtronics, Futaba etc) horns fit on Ofna servos? I'm looking to get aluminum horns...I know Ofna sells them, but my hobby store doesn't carry Ofna brand servos, just everything else.
 
I thought OFNA servos were the same as Futaba. I could be wrong.

Anyhow, when you buy alum servo horns you should get 3 different spline adapters. So no matter what servo you have they should work.

I have purchased OFNA and Dynamite alum horns and both of the came with the J, A and F adapters.
 
None of the ones that the hobby store sells comes with splines, they're just straight alum. They're packaged as being for specific makes. One packaged for J, A. Another for Futaba. I could have just grabbed one and tried it out, but I just didn't want to waste $6 and get the wrong one.
